  • Is this course for you?

    Level 2 Diploma in Nail Technology is a new and exciting course that the college is proud to offer. This course specialises in gel products, allowing you to take your first steps into being a qualified Nail Technician. It will provide you with the basis of building your knowledge of the nail technology industry, giving you the skills to master other forms such as acrylic, silk and fibreglass and poylgel. This is a vocational qualification designed for learners seeking a career specialising in nail technology.

    As a trainee nail technician, you will learn in a training salon furnished with industry standard equipment and working reception. You will be introduced to the profession through practical demonstrations of key treatments, such as manicure, pedicure, gel polish application and nail enhancements in gel. You will learn a variety of skills, including practical application, health and safety and anatomy and physiology of the hands and nail.

  • Required qualifications

    You will need to have three GCSEs at Grade 4 (C Grade), including Maths or English. If you do not have Grade 4 in Maths or English, you will be required to complete this qualification at college alongside your vocational course. You will be an enthusiastic and dedicated learner who is passionate about the industry, and willing to learn and try new skills.

  • What skills will I develop?

    By completing this qualification you will become a skilled nail technician, offering treatments including nail enhancements through gel and fiberglass, gel polish and nail art, manicure and pedicure. Your essential knowledge will include client care, health and safety and anatomy and physiology. You will learn through a variety of assessments, including practical and written where you will receive feedback from both your peers and your tutors.

  • Careers

    Once you have completed a Level 2 Diploma in Nail Technology, your next steps could be:

    • Self-employed Nail Technician
    • Beauty salon nail technician
    • Nail bar technician
    • Retail and training
    • Cruise liners
    • Photographic or media work

    The beauty sector is steadily growing within the West Midland’s currently employing around 4,000, this is expected to grow around 2.6% within the next 3 years.

  • Work experience

    Work experience is a compulsory aspect of the course. This is designed to harmonise the theory you will learn in class and the real world applications of the course. Through work experience, you will learn valuable skills, such as interpersonal skills, independence, confidence and commercial awareness.
